Meaning of officious
officious (s)
intrusive in a meddling or offensive manner
officious (a.)
Pertaining to, or being in accordance with, duty.
Disposed to serve; kind; obliging.
Importunately interposing services; intermeddling in affairs in which one has no concern; meddlesome.
